Project Kahn And Cosworth Team-Up To Customize Range Rover Evoque

Project Kahn Cosworth Range Rover Evoque

The British tuner Project Kahn and the specialists of Cosworth team-up to give birth to a complete tuning package, specially built for the five-door version of Range Rover Evoque.

The new five-door Range Rover Evoque was just launched at Los Angeles Auto Show already attracted the looks of the British tuners of Project Kahn, specialized in modifying the models of the English automaker. In order to build a high-quality tuning kit, Project Kahn teams-up with the guys of Cosworth, which will probably handle the technical details of the model.

For now, the two partners have only unveiled a teaser pic of their creation, a picture that is not showing up too many details of the Project Kahn and Cosworth tuning package. The improvements brought by Project Kahn are discrete, the Brits only applying some vinyls, a new special color, also replacing the stock rims with some custom white ones.

The partnership with Cosworth might bring the five-door Range Rover Evoque, the public expecting a reinterpretation of the Si4 version, powered by a 2.0-liter Ecoboost engine developing 240 HP.

Anyway, to imagine what the Evoque will hide under its hood is in vain, as I am pretty sure that Project Kahn and Cosworth are preparing something special for us.
